How to fix stringing in wall thickness 3D models?

To fix stringing in wall-thickness 3D models, focus on 4 key steps to stop molten filament oozing between wall sections: adjust retraction, lower nozzle temperature, increase travel speed, and maintain filament/nozzle.

1. **Retraction**: Increase retraction distance (1-3mm) or speed (30-60mm/s) to pull filament back during nozzle travel—this stops drips before they reach thin walls. 2. **Temperature**: Lower nozzle temp by 5-10°C—less fluid filament is less likely to ooze while the nozzle moves. 3. **Travel speed**: Boost speed to 50-100mm/s—faster moves reduce the time filament has to drip between walls. 4. **Maintenance**: Clean a clogged nozzle (use a needle) or dry damp filament (store in a dryer—PLA/PETG absorb moisture easily, worsening oozing).

These steps target the main causes of stringing in thin-wall prints, making adjustments simple and effective for cleaner results.
